Transaction ebda11023ed71aa3b88333127fbcf98d0a323a6567cdbbc85806bdf524cd0195

2 Input
2 Outputs
  • ebda11023ed71aa3b88333127fbcf98d0a323a6567cdbbc85806bdf524cd0195:0
  • value  593330464
    address  3CuqkxakhaDwfFEyM72ydtbaV4jUfn9D1j
  • ebda11023ed71aa3b88333127fbcf98d0a323a6567cdbbc85806bdf524cd0195:1
  • value  54620805
    address  1E3C2ezDHxnL2r4iqdgm1Vdq3Pfv3K22Tc